Characterization of PM2.5–bound Polycyclic Aromatic Hydrocarbons in Chiang Mai, Thailand during Biomass Open Burning Period of 2016

Polycyclic aromatic hydrocarbons (PAHs) bounded to ambient fine particles (PM2.5) were determined for enabling health risk assessment and source identification of ambient aerosols.
